Template:Characterbox Armored Banana Boys are enemies that are found in Metalhead and appeared in Spyro the Dragon. They are armored versions of the Banana Boys. Because of their armor, they can only be defeated by charging.

Description

Armored Banana Boys hurl bananas at Spyro to attack him. They are often thrown at him by Strongarms, making them roll over him. Metalhead is also known to throw the Boys. If they don't hit Spyro during their roll, they will keep rolling until they eventually disappear.

Trivia

  • Similarly to their Tree Tops relatives, Armored Banana Boys throw entire bunches of bananas at Spyro.
